Davis 910th Airlift Wing Public Affairs YOUNGSTOWN AIR RESERVE STATION, Ohio -- The 910th Airlift Wing held a response exercise here Nov. 29. The purpose of the exercise was to evaluate wing response, command, control and communications. A scenario was played out involving a simulated terrorist use of toxic agents.
